**Duties**
- Perform repairs on damaged vehicles, including bodywork, frame straightening, and paint refinishing.
- Utilize hand tools and power tools safely and effectively to complete repairs.
- Assess vehicle damage and determine the necessary repairs needed for restoration.
- Collaborate with team members to ensure timely completion of projects while maintaining high-quality standards.
- Maintain a clean and organized work area, adhering to safety protocols at all times.
- Keep accurate records of repairs performed and parts used for each vehicle.
- Stay updated on industry trends and advancements in automotive repair techniques.
